Hanan Al-Shaykh

Hanan Al-Shaykh—an award-winning journalist, novelist, and playwright—is the author of the story collections I Sweep the Sun Off Rooftops and One Thousand and One Nights; the novels Suicide of a Dead Man, The Praying Mantis, The Story of Zahra, Women of Sand and Myrrh, Beirut Blues, Only in London, and The Occasional Virgin; and a memoir about her mother, The Locust and the Bird. She was raised in Beirut and educated in Cairo, and she lives in London.
